Synthesis of Si Nanowires for an Anode Material of Li Batteries
Abstract
The work encompassed the study of new alloy anode material for the next generation of Li ion battery. The alloy includes Li alloy with Sn, Al and Si. It has been reported that the Li4.4Si alloy can have the theoretical capacity of 4200 mAhr/g, which is much higher than the capacity of the graphite. However, in spite of the theoretical prediction, the immense volume increase, thus capacitance decrease occurred during charging and discharging. Therefore, the work focused on the study of morphological and volume change of the Li Si alloy electrodes. The result of the study is expected to contribute to the future work of the Li alloy anode development for the improved capacitance.
